The industry term for this is a 'spiff.' I had a brief stint at an AT&T store back before Blackberry died and in addition to the normal commission (of which the iPhone has the lowest of any phone, due to low margins for the retail store), Blackberry would pay a ~$30 spiff for selling their new phone. I couldn't sell any. Samsung was giving around $20, if I recall correctly, for selling whatever the newest Galaxy S was at the time. Just to be clear, a sales associate can easily make ten times as much money by selling you something without an Apple logo on it, and this absolutely motivates them to push stuff on you.
